الملخص EN

This paper is concerned with dynamic output feedback controller (DOFC) design problem for singular fractional-order systems with the fractional-order α satisfying 0<α<2.

Based on the stability theory of fractional-order system, sufficient and necessary conditions are derived for the admissibility of the systems, which are more convenient to analytical design of stabilizing controllers than the existing results.

A full-order DOFC is then synthesized based on the obtained conditions and the characteristics of Moore-Penrose inverse.

Finally, a numerical example is presented to show the effectiveness of the proposed methods.
